Pakistan Received $3.2b in Remittances During September

Islamabad: Pakistan received 3.2 billion dollars in remittances during the month of September this year.

According to Radio Pakistan, inflows hit 9.5 billion dollars in the first quarter of the current fiscal year as compared to 8.8 billion dollars during the corresponding period last year.

The Finance Ministry in its statement said that remittances are a lifeline for households and a cushion for our external account.
